Job Description
We are seeking a skilled and experienced electronics assembler to perform a wide range of assembly operations on complex electronic and electro-mechanical components, sub-assemblies, and finished units.
About the Role:
- Assemble electronic and electro-mechanical units and systems using hand tools, power tools, and other assembly equipment.
- Perform wiring, component installation, hand soldering, cable harnessing, and mechanical assembly in accordance with engineering drawings and specifications.
- Interpret and follow blueprints, schematics, and work instructions to determine the sequence of operations.
- Set up and adjust tools and equipment as needed, ensuring all tolerances meet required specifications.
- Perform quality inspections to verify product conformance to specifications and troubleshoot assembly issues when necessary.
- Collaborate with engineering and quality teams to support continuous improvement and resolve technical issues.
- Document work completed, report production data, and assist in training junior team members when required.
Requirements:
- Minimum of 4–6 years of hands-on experience in electronic or electro-mechanical assembly.
- Proficient in hand soldering (including surface-mount and through-hole components).
- Experience with cable harnessing, wiring, and assembly of mechanical enclosures.
- Requires use of microscopes, soldering irons, and other precision tools.
- Wiring/Soldering/Harnessing technical certification or associate degree in electronics or related field preferred.
